Kuidas teha CPP -s nelja funktsionaalset kalkulaatorit: 6 sammu
Kuidas teha CPP -s nelja funktsionaalset kalkulaatorit: 6 sammu
Anonim
KUIDAS CPP -s NELI FUNKTSIONAALSET KALKULAATORIT TEHA
KUIDAS CPP -s NELI FUNKTSIONAALSET KALKULAATORIT TEHA

Kalkulaatorid on igapäevaelus kõigile harjunud. Lihtsa kalkulaatori saab teha C ++ programmi abil, mis suudab liita, lahutada, korrutada ja jagada kahte kasutaja sisestatud operandi. Kui ja goto lauset kasutatakse kalkulaatori loomiseks.

Samm: avage IDE

Avage IDE
Avage IDE

saate kasutada mis tahes tüüpi IDE -d

nt geenius, cfree, visuaalstuudio jne….

Samm: projekti salvestamine laiendiga ".cpp"

Salvestage projekt laiendiga
Salvestage projekt laiendiga

Samm: kopeerige allpool toodud kood ja kleepige see kompilaatori IDE -sse

#kaasake

kasutades nimeruumi std; int main () {char a; ujuk z; goto r; r: {süsteem ("cls"); cout << "sisestamiseks '+' lisamiseks" << endl << "sisesta '-' lahutamiseks" << endl << "sisesta '*' korrutamiseks" << endl << "sisesta '/' jagamiseks" a; kui (a == '+') {float x, y; cout << "sisesta esimene number" x; cout << "sisesta teine number" y; z = x+y; cout << "summa" << x << "+" << y << "=" << z << endl; } muidu kui (a == '-') {float x, y; cout << "sisesta esimene number" x; cout << "sisesta teine number" y; z = x-y; cout << "lahutamine" << x << "-" << y << "=" << z << endl; } else if (a == '*') {float x, y; cout << "sisesta esimene number" x; cout << "sisesta teine number" y; z = x*y; cout << "multiplikatiivne korrutis" << x << "*" << y << "=" << z << endl; } else if (a == '/') {float x, y; ujuk z; cout << "sisesta esimene number" x; cout << "sisesta teine number" y; z = x/a; cout << "jaotus" << x << "/" << y << "=" << z << endl; } else {cout << "tundmatu toiming / n"; } goto p; } p: cout << "jätkamiseks sisesta 'r'" << endla; kui (a == 'r') {goto r; } muidu kui (a == 'c') {goto e; } muu {goto p; } e: {}}